"Many of you are familiar with the details of what happened down here in Nueces County (Corpus Christi). For those of you who are not, here is a brief synopsis.
At my precinct convention, we elected 13 delegates and no alternates. Soon after my precinct convention adjourned, I was in the parking lot having a conversation with our former State Representative when our Precinct Chairman joined in on our conversation. She thanked us for coming and told us she was headed home to "go through the book" looking for people to add to our delegate list. We were allowed 29 delegates and she wanted to "fill in all the slots". I immediately thought this was strange. A few days later, I requested a copy of my precinct minutes from our County Chairman. I wanted to talk with fellow precinct delegates to see if they shared the same concern about our precinct chair adding people to our delegate list without a vote. The County Chairman refused to give me copies of the minutes or a list of the delegates elected from my precinct. During the same conversation, I asked him if I could sit in on the Resolutions Committee meeting (my State Rep recommended that I do so in an effort to better understand the convention process). Our county Chairman told me that the committee members had already been selected and that he was not going to give me the information about the meetings. Again, I thought this was strange. Within the next few days I discovered the "2006 Republican Party of Texas Rules" (http://www.texasgop.org/s...). After reading these rules, specifically rule 14 and rule 22b, I realized that all of the meetings are open to any delegate and that the precinct convention minutes are public record. I decided to email the County Chairman and ask again. Again, he refused. As a result, I filed a challenge (see attached Bertuzzi challenge).
On the day of our County Convention, as I was registering I noticed that indeed our precinct Chairman had added delegates to my precinct after the precinct convention had adjourned. I also noticed that I was not the only person with the same concern. Many others in different precincts were having the same problem. Here is the audio and explanation of what happened at the Nueces County Convention. http://youtube.com/watch?...
I also filed a writ of mandamus in an effort to get a copy of the precinct convention minutes for all precincts in Nueces County (see attached mandamus). Despite Tina Benkiser calling my lawsuit frivolous (http://youtube.com/watch?...), the court ruled in my favor and granted me access to all precinct convention minutes (see attached court order).
In reviewing the minutes received through the court order, here is what was found...
151 delegates were added to the temporary roll of the county convention who were NOT elected at their precinct convention (not elected as delegates or alternates)
35 delegates were added who did not vote in the Republican Party Primary (some of which voted in the DEM Primary, some of which are not registered to vote at all)
36 delegates were added by the Credentials Committee whose names are not on the temporary roll or on Exhibit "B" (elected delegates) from their precinct
Included in the 151 illegally added delegates are the following:
Chairman of the Credentials Committee, Kendall Peterson
Chairman of the Nominations Committee, Art Granado
Chairman of the Permanent Organization Committee, Al Torres
Chairman of the Resolutions Committee, Victor Bird
County Convention Secretary, Angelica "Angie" Flores
SREC (SD 20) Representative, Bob Jones
11 Total Convention Committee Members
8 Republican Candidates
233 delegates were present at the Nueces County Convention. 155 delegates were illegally added (not elected at their precinct).
98 of the delegates present at the County Convention were legally elected.
As a result of the events at the County Convention, 46 delegates participated in a rump convention. (almost half of the legally elected delegates)
Gary Polland, Debra Medina's attorney, has agreed to take our case. The goal with the court case is to nullify the Senatorial Caucus (SD 20) and Congressional Caucus (CD 27) that were held by illegally elected delegates from Nueces County (these took place at the state convention). We are also seeking punitive damages from those who are responsible for the events of the Nueces County Republican Convention and the violations against our civil rights.
